The Role

This role is about creating physical and emotional safety, building trust gradually and providing support without judgement or confrontation.

You’ll Support a Customer To

  • Maintain daily routines and wellbeing
  • Participate in meaningful activities at home
  • Build independence through patient, age-appropriate support
  • Receive consistent and reassuring communication
  • Exercise choice, dignity and control
  • Engage with support at their own pace

You Will Also

  • Follow Behaviour Support Plans, risk controls and agreed strategies
  • Recognise triggers and early signs of distress
  • Respond safely to verbal escalation, threats or behaviours that may present a physical risk
  • Maintain appropriate observation and situational awareness
  • Complete accurate progress notes and incident reports
